About This Blog
Big truths hide in life’s smallest details—if you’re high-minded enough to notice.
Welcome to The Stoic Stoner—a blog that thinks out loud, jams on ideas, and believes wisdom isn’t something you memorize… it’s something you grow into.
Here, we don’t preach. We just pass the mic.
We explore big questions through stories, parables, riffs, and raw reflections. We don’t expect you to be perfect. We just start from wherever you are—and light the path forward from there.
You’ll find that this blog moves in grooves:
- Sermon on the Blunt – Street wisdom and stoic calm, lit with reverence and a little rebellion.
- Aesop After Dark – Grown-up parables for late-night minds.
- The Washdown Chronicles – Tales of humility, grace, and finding peace in dirty places.
- Captain Tom Speaks – Offbeat, bluesy life lessons from a guitar-slinging old soul.
- Mirror, Mirror in the Void, Sunburned Pride, and more—each series its own trip, its own tone.
At the heart of it all is a simple idea:
When you come face to face with the vastness of the universe—or the possibility of a Creator—you start to feel small. And that's the beginning of light.
Because every star shines in the dark. Regardless of size.
This blog isn’t about arguing. It’s not here to convert you, corner you, or corner itself. It’s a quiet place for people trying to see more clearly.
We sneak up on truth like a monk in combat boots, with a blunt in one hand and a lamp in the other.
So take a breath. Read slow. Follow the light from wherever you're standing.
